Rock Band 3 Pro Guitar, Box Art, And Pricing Revealed

by Bryan Vore on Jun 11, 2010 at 02:15 PM


In addition to unveiling the first details about the gameplay in Rock Band 3, Harmonix is also being very forthcoming about the new hardware. Read on for prices and pics.

Mad Catz is now completely taking over peripheral duties from Harmonix and MTV Games. While they will be releasing new traditional Rock Band guitars, drums, and "improved" mics, today we've got the full rundown on the new keyboard, fancy pro guitar, and other odds and sods. ·Rock Band 3 Wireless Keyboard Controller: $79.99

·Rock Band 3 Game & Wireless Keyboard Controller Bundle: $129.99


"Designed for use exclusively with Rock Band 3, the Wireless Keyboard Controller has been crafted to resemble classic professional keyboards and is playable on a secure flat surface or while strapped over the player’s shoulder. Empowering gamers to take their enjoyment of rhythm music gaming to the next level, the Wireless Keyboard Controller also functions as a MIDI keyboard, boasting a two-octave (C3 to C5) range and non-weighted, velocity-sensitive key bed allowing gamers to take full advantage of the Rock Band Pro mode. The MIDI output connector provides compatibility with MIDI software sequencers and hardware devices while standard console-specific gaming controller buttons deliver seamless console integration and the Wireless Keyboard Controller can also be used to play the lead guitar or bass parts of the game. An optional Keyboard Stand will be sold separately and is expected to be available alongside the launch of Rock Band 3."



·Rock Band 3 Wireless Fender Mustang PRO-Guitar Controller: $149.99

"Introducing a new level of realism to the rhythm music genre, the Wireless Fender Mustang PRO-GuitarController is designed for use exclusively with Rock Band 3, allowing gamers to accurately replicate a real guitar when playing Rock Band Pro mode in the game.  Featuring 17 frets along a button-based neck, the Fender Mustang PRO-Guitar includes a 6-string strumming area which allows for discrete picking of each string and a touch-sensitive string box which allows players to mute or ‘cut-off’ notes when pressed.  In addition, the Fender Mustang PRO-Guitar operates as a fully functional MIDI guitar, with the MIDI output connector providing compatibility with MIDI software sequencers and hardware devices while standard console-specific gaming controller buttons deliver seamless console integration and navigation of the game menus. The Fender Mustang PRO-Guitar allows for left or right handed use and can also be used to play either lead or bass parts of the game in Rock Band Pro and standard game modes."



·Rock Band 3 Wireless PRO-Cymbals Expansion Kit: $39.99

"Compatible with all wireless Rock Band drum kits, the Wireless PRO-Cymbals Expansion Kit features three newly designed Rock Band 3 cymbals which have been re-engineered for quiet operation.  Fully supporting the Rock Band Pro mode where the cymbals represent Hi-Hat, Crash and Ride, the cymbals can also be used in standard game modes for all Rock Band software. Improved from the Rock Band™ 2 cymbals, the new PRO-Cymbals boast quieter sound with noise-dampening rubber covering the full surface area of the cymbal. The PRO-Cymbals also feature enhanced responsiveness, essential when playing in Rock Band Pro mode. In addition, the redesigned Rock Band 3 cymbals now permanently rest at a pre-defined 10° angle, better positioned for accurate play.  The PRO-Cymbals are also available as part of the Rock Band 3 Wireless Drum and Cymbal Kit (sold separately)."



· Rock Band 3 MIDI PRO-Adapter: $39.99

"Designed for use exclusively with Rock Band 3, theMIDI PRO-Adapter allows musicians to use their real MIDI keyboards or MIDI drum sets to play Rock Band 3.  Plugging directly into the console via USB, the MIDI PRO-Adapter works as an interface between the console and MIDI instrument, converting the MIDI messages into console controller data which the game translates into on screen action.  The MIDI PRO-Adapter features a velocity sensitive adjustment for MIDI drums designed to reduce cross-talk during play.  A full D-Pad and standard gaming controller buttons are located on the PRO-Adapter to deliver seamless console integration and navigation of the game menus.  Shipswith a removable clip, allowing MIDI PRO-Adapter to be attached to a belt, or rest on a table top or similar flat surface."
